Winsor & Newton Professional Watercolour 5ml - Oxide of Chromium (Series 3) 0118605
29.99 AUD
Category: Winsor & Newton Watercolour 5ml
Oxide of Chromium is an opaque willow green pigment. Though discovered in 1809 it was only made available for artists in 1862. Today, it is commonly used for camouflage clothing.

Winsor & Newton Professional Watercolour 5ml - Antwerp Blue (Series 1) 0118126
20.99 AUD
Category: Winsor & Newton Watercolour 5ml
Antwerp blue is a rich transparent blue colour. It is a softer version of Prussian Blue which was the first synthetic blue pigment. It was made by German chemist Diesbach around 1704.

Winsor & Newton Professional Watercolour 5ml - Quinacridone Magenta (Series 3) 0118672
29.99 AUD
Category: Winsor & Newton Watercolour 5ml
Quinacridone Magenta is a rich deep violet-red colour. It is based on the Quinacridone pigment. The name Magenta comes from a lake colour named in 1859 after the battle in Magenta, Italy.

Winsor & Newton Professional Watercolour 5ml - Cobalt Blue (Series 4) 0118362
36.99 AUD
Category: Winsor & Newton Watercolour 5ml
Cobalt Blue is a clean blue pigment. It was discovered in 1802 by French chemist Louis Thénard as an alternative pigment to the expensive Lapis Lazuli blue pigment.
